+#ifndef __BLI_SORT_UTILS_H__
+#define __BLI_SORT_UTILS_H__
+
+/** \file BLI_sort_utils.h
+ *  \ingroup bli
+ */
+
+/**
+ * \note keep \a sort_value first,
+ * so cmp functions can be reused.
+ */
+struct SortPointerByFloat {
+	float sort_value;
+	void *data;
+};
+
+struct SortIntByFloat {
+	float sort_value;
+	int data;
+};
+
+struct SortPointerByInt {
+	int sort_value;
+	void *data;
+};
+
+struct SortIntByInt {
+	int sort_value;
+	int data;
+};
+
+int BLI_sortutil_cmp_float(const void *a_, const void *b_);
+int BLI_sortutil_cmp_float_reverse(const void *a_, const void *b_);
+
+int BLI_sortutil_cmp_int(const void *a_, const void *b_);
+int BLI_sortutil_cmp_int_reverse(const void *a_, const void *b_);
+
+#endif  /* __BLI_SORT_UTILS_H__ */

+/** \file blender/blenlib/intern/sort_utils.c
+ *  \ingroup bli
+ *
+ * Utility functions for sorting common types.
+ */
+
+#include "BLI_sort_utils.h"  /* own include */
+
+struct SortAnyByFloat {
+	float sort_value;
+};
+
+struct SortAnyByInt {
+	int sort_value;
+};
+
+int BLI_sortutil_cmp_float(const void *a_, const void *b_)
+{
+	const struct SortAnyByFloat *a = a_;
+	const struct SortAnyByFloat *b = b_;
+	if      (a->sort_value > b->sort_value) return  1;
+	else if (a->sort_value < b->sort_value) return -1;
+	else                                    return  0;
+}
+
+int BLI_sortutil_cmp_float_reverse(const void *a_, const void *b_)
+{
+	const struct SortAnyByFloat *a = a_;
+	const struct SortAnyByFloat *b = b_;
+	if      (a->sort_value < b->sort_value) return  1;
+	else if (a->sort_value > b->sort_value) return -1;
+	else                                    return  0;
+}
+
+int BLI_sortutil_cmp_int(const void *a_, const void *b_)
+{
+	const struct SortAnyByInt *a = a_;
+	const struct SortAnyByInt *b = b_;
+	if      (a->sort_value > b->sort_value) return  1;
+	else if (a->sort_value < b->sort_value) return -1;
+	else                                    return  0;
+}
+
+int BLI_sortutil_cmp_int_reverse(const void *a_, const void *b_)
+{
+	const struct SortAnyByInt *a = a_;
+	const struct SortAnyByInt *b = b_;
+	if      (a->sort_value < b->sort_value) return  1;
+	else if (a->sort_value > b->sort_value) return -1;
+	else                                    return  0;
+}
